    Another option is the "Pino Kettle" which has the advantage of being
    precisely adjustable to any temp you desire through a digital control.
    Set it for 193 degrees and thats what you get, set it for 148, 162,
    whatever.

    http://www.pino-usa2.com/kettles.php

    I reviewed the prototype a few years ago, you can see my take on it
    here
    http://www.pu-erh.net/phpBB/nfphpbb/viewtopic.php?t=250

    I use it at work everyday for the last year and a half and no problems
    so far. I really like being able to dial in whatever temp I want,
    especially great for greens and whites.
